Werkspoorfabriek - from derelict to extraordinary


Zecc Architects has together with Wunderhund Studios converted a derelict steel construction factory in Werkspoor, Utrecht, into a workspace for over fifty businesses and creative entrepreneurs. The building includes offices, workshops and hospitality spaces, all nested within this classic example of Dutch industrial heritage.

Make it big 
With a building this size, Zecc architects wanted to make big gestures. Wunderhund Studios were appointed responsible for the design of the Stadstuin area where BAUX is installed. The concept was to keep the scale and spaciousness and create new spaces for businesses to flourish. Much of the original brick, glass and steel features have been kept to preserve the character and identity of the building and the design team retained the factory’s linear form by ensuring it was possible to walk the entire length of the interior space. The building inspires with its spectacular height, inviting interior vistas and when night falls, the large glass factory walls illuminate the surrounding area.

Black Acoustic panels stretching 15 metres

In keeping with the scale of the building, Wunderhund and Zecc wanted a grand visual statement in the main entrance of the building. An impressive BAUX Panels wall stretches 15 metres from floor to ceiling, connecting the main entrance to a hospitality space. They chose just one colour for the BAUX Panels wall with stunning effect. Black BAUX acoustic wood wool Panels form interlocking patterns that weave textures into the space. At a distance, the wood wool panels accent the black steel staircases, and as you move closer, the panels reveal wooden fibres bringing another dimension to the patterning.

Mixing materials – benefits and drawbacks

As with any large interior space, Werkspoorfabriek offers impressive interior dimensions with one considerable drawback. Acoustics. In large open spaces, sound reflections can easily create troublesome background noise. In the central entrance area, where the hospitality space is located, the acoustics had to be perfect. The acoustic performance of BAUX Acoustic Panels has dampened sound reflections from the building’s concrete floors and high glass walls, creating a homely space for relaxation and conversation.
